BIKE NEWPORT BIKE NEWPORT'S MISSION IS TO ENSURE THAT BICYCLING IS A VIABLE, SAFE, AND COMFORTABLE PRIMARY CHOICE FOR TRANSPORTATION AND RECREATION.

Financial History

YearRevenueExpensesAssets
2024$973,980$1,028,157$585,930
2023$995,378$834,108$605,536
2022$745,014$699,003$458,011
2021$652,886$467,652$387,587
2020$485,037$371,406$201,627
2019$442,453$480,996$103,387
2018$484,439$504,116$143,806
